Details of IFSC Code for Hdfc Bank, Guda Gorji, Jhunjhunun
Here are some of the key details that come with the IFSC Code HDFC0005131 of Hdfc Bank for its branch located in Jhunjhunun, within the district of Gudha Gorji in the state of Rajasthan.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Hdfc Bank |
| IFSC Code | HDFC0005131 |
| Branch | Guda Gorji |
| City | Jhunjhunun |
| District | Gudha Gorji |
| State | Rajasthan |
| Address | Grd Floor Shop No 24 To 29 Guda Big Bazar Udaipurwati Road Guda Gorji Gudha Gorji Rajasthan 333022 |

Format of the IFSC Code HDFC0005131
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Hdfc Bank,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Hdfc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
- 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Guda Gorji in Jhunjhunun.
For example, the IFSC Code HDFC0005131 of Hdfc Bank for the Guda Gorji bran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Jhunjhunun and Rajasthan accurately.
